The 2026 value proposition of Beats Solo Buds
The Beats Solo Buds have maintained their popularity due to their unique architecture. Featuring the smallest case in the brand's history and an impressive 18 hours of battery life on a single charge, they represent a peak in portable audio engineering. In 2026, while newer models have emerged, the Solo Buds remain the preferred choice for users prioritizing a minimalist footprint without sacrificing the signature Beats acoustic profile. US retailers like Amazon, Best Buy, and Target often carry exclusive colorways—such as Transparent Red and Arctic Purple—that are rarely available through official channels in mainland China.

When we analyze the total landed cost, the financial benefit of direct importation becomes clear. The US retail price typically sits at $79.99. Even after accounting for international shipping rates, the total cost rarely exceeds 750 RMB. In contrast, reputable resellers in China often list the same product for upwards of 1,150 RMB to cover their import overheads. You can use a shipping calculator to verify that the light weight of these earbuds (approximately 0.3kg with packaging) results in minimal shipping fees, maximizing your total savings.
Overcoming US retailer credit card restrictions
A significant hurdle for Chinese shoppers is the strict payment security protocols used by major US vendors. Stores such as Nike, Sephora, and Apple frequently block international credit cards or cancel orders directed toward known shipping hubs. This is not a reflection of your creditworthiness but rather a rigid geographic restriction on their sales software.

Customs and import considerations for China
Importing electronics into China requires an understanding of the General Administration of Customs (GACC) regulations. While personal effect shipments are standard, being aware of current import tax thresholds is essential to avoid unexpected costs at the border. Generally, for items like earbuds, the duty is manageable if the declared value is accurate and the quantity is consistent with personal use.
